>>>
>>> This is nearly impossible to handle.
>>> Please add defines for 0x1, 0x103 and 0x303. Also please consider
>>> adding comments for the devices.
>>>
>>
>> Ack, Initially added the comments for devices, but since only driver is
>> handling this data, and clients won't refer this so removed it. Will
>> consider adding it back.
> 
> It will help developers / porters who will try matching the SID and the device.
> 

Agree on the same, I'll add those comments for devices back.

>>   This actlr field value might different (other
>> than 0x1,0x103,0x303) in other platforms as per my anticipation,
>> depending on the bit settings, so won't the defines change with
>> different platforms? Hence this register setting value might be apt?
> 
> It is simple. 0x1, 0x103 and 0x303 are pure magic values. Please
> provide sensible defines so that we can understand and review them.
>

Understandable, In next patch I'll populate the actlr_data in
following format { SID, MASK, PRE_FETCH_n | CPRE | CMTLB }.
where " PRE_FETCH_n | CPRE | CMTLB " will be defines for
the actlr values (0x1,0x103,0x303).
This would help in understanding these values. Hope this
proposed format will be okay?


> Other platforms might use new defines.
